We are building Shram to make boring work management fun, engaging and meaningful. How?
❇️ Based on the tasks that you complete, you earn weekly XP.
❇️ Based on your activity, you gain monthly badges that teammates can steal from you.
❇️ All work data is automatically compiled into a work report can be used as a reference for performance evaluations saving you time and effort.

In terms of product updates wrt Shram 1.0, we have improved a LOT:
☀️ All new UI - Unlike a completely new interface like before, now we have one that is easier to start with
🍃 Simple organisation - Now you just have folders that you can infinitely nest work in, unlike a fixed hierarchy before
✨ AI-powered insights - AI-generated real-time summaries of ongoing work and holistic work reports
🏆 Better gamification - Monthly badges and weekly XP bars
🎯 New ways to oversee work - We have overview, list view, table view and a Kanban board
🔍 Search in natural language - Search by your memory, not keywords
⌨️ Keyboard shortcuts - No need to switch between your keyboard and mouse
☎️ Live in-app support - Just speak to us anytime within Shram
